Outbreak probed
Source: The Sangai Express
Imphal, July 10 2020:
The case of Chicken Pox outbreak in Kwakta Ward numbers 6 and 7, reported in the media has been investigated by the IDSP unit, Bishnupur today.
According to a statement of Chief Medical Officer of Bishnupur L Gojendra Singh, eight people of three families were found infected or recovered during the investigation.
Only two persons are in the active stage.
The team further traced the origin of the outbreak to a 13-year-old child who was infected one month back.
Awareness on good nutrition, routine immunization, sanitation and hygiene has been given to prevent such common infectious disease in the community, it said.
"The people were also motivated to visit the nearby PHC when such diseases occur," it said.
"Chicken Pox is a low priority disease because of its low mortality rate however, people in general avoid going to health centres on the wrong notion that medicine from doctors has harmful effects," it said.
A vaccine is available but not included in the National Immunization Programme of Health Ministry, it added.
